AI Technical Summary

Technical Problem

In multiphase mixtures, the problem that existing reference intensity methods cannot be used is that it is impossible to determine the reference intensity values ​​of multiple phases, especially when the value is not available in the PDF card or the database is missing, which makes it impossible to apply the reference intensity method to quantitative analysis.

Method used

By adding standard samples of different contents to a multiphase mixture and mixing them evenly, XRD measurements are performed to extract the intensity of the strongest diffraction peak of each phase. The reference intensity value of the multiphase mixed sample is then solved using a set of equations, thereby completing the quantitative analysis.

Benefits of technology

In the absence of reference intensity values, the reference intensity values ​​of multiple phases can be accurately determined with a quantitative result error of less than 2%, solving the problem that the reference intensity method cannot be used and realizing simple and accurate quantitative analysis.

Abstract

本发明公开一种同时求解多种物相参比强度的方法,属于X射线定量分析技术领域。本发明通过在多相混合物中添加不同含量的标准样品混合均匀后,进行XRD测量,提取各物相最强衍射峰强度I,此时将标准样品和未知参比强度值的物相最强衍射峰强度值代入方程组,求出未知物相的参比强度值,即可代入参比强度法公式完成定量分析,解决了工业生产中多相混合物在参比强度值未知时无法利用参比强度法进行定量分析的问题,并且所述方法得到的定量结果准确,误差在2%以内。
